Specifically, host computer described in the present embodiment classification processing is carried out to the communication data or file transmission information, it is excellent
The processing of first level or subpackage handles and formed in packet transmit queue first when having communication data or file to transmit in application program
When information is sent to destination address, then communication data or file transmission information are carried out at classification according to type, the size of data
Reason or subpackage processing;For example, when the data volume of the file transmission information is more than a setting value, then by the file transmission information
It is divided at least two less packets, and then improves the efficiency of the cross-platform data communication.Then the network is called
Operate the correlation function in dynamic base and get through path;Call correlation function in the network communication dynamic base and will be categorized
Communication data or file transfer data after processing or subpackage processing are according to priority put into corresponding team in packet transmit queue
In row;Finally each queue according to priority in algorithm queries packet transmit queue, the data of each queue are sent to mesh
Address.Wherein, the packet transmit queue is according to priority followed successively by from high to low:Instant transmit queue, order sends team
Arrange, fast memory queue, middling speed memory queue, at a slow speed memory queue and document queue, wherein, it may include in each queue multiple
Packet or file, and then make on the efficiency basis for improve data communication there is provided one kind in stand-alone application interprogram communication
With and the data communications method that uses of different machines inter-application communication.
Wherein, the subpackage processing includes:
Whether the size of packet is judged more than a setting value, if it is, performing next step;If it is not, then carrying out excellent
First level processing;
The network load of Ethernet is detected, judges whether the network load of the Ethernet exceedes threshold value, if it is, performing
Next step;If it is not, then carrying out priority processing;
Subpackage quantity is determined according to the network load of the size Ethernet of packet, and presses the subpackage quantity by packet
Carry out subpackage.And then the effective load monitoring realized to Ethernet, it is ensured that the data communication efficiency.Wherein, the present embodiment
Described in method Ethernet network load not more than 20%, it is preferred that the network load of the Ethernet is less than
10%.
Communication data described in the present embodiment includes state data packets, real time data table packet, historical data number between station
According to bag, order bag, request bag etc. network transmission in need packet;File transmission information includes configuration file, configuration text
Part, Log files etc. network transmission in need and synchronization file data.The data communications method by above-mentioned internal storage data,
The multiple types of data such as real time data, order data, operational order, file data, status data, response data bag is by above-mentioned
Classification processing, the packet transmit queue that is formed after priority processing or subpackage processing, Windows operating system or in
Transmitted between the host computer and slave computer of mark kylin operating system or between host computer and host computer by the above method,
Avoid Windows operating system or get the bid kylin operating system host computer and slave computer between or host computer with it is upper
The incompatibility of data between the machine of position, the problem of can not transmit mutually, and then improve the data communications method flexibility,
Autgmentability and lower coupling.
In summary, method described in the present embodiment first by communication data or file transfer data carry out classification processing or
Corresponding packet is formed after subpackage processing, then by carrying out priority processing formation packet transmit queue to packet,
And then the two priority classes to packet transmit queue are realized according to the priority algorithm, so that different priority data bags
Principle is first sent according to high priority to be handled, it is ensured that significant data is preferentially sent, and then improve treatment effeciency during transmission.

Specifically, the present embodiment methods described by each queue according to network communication interface when being issued to slave computer, institute
State the packet that slave computer sent the packet within queue and receive reception data queue, and the data in data queue will be received
Bag correspondence carries out dissection process, extracts corresponding order and performs, for example, methods described can pass through Process flowchart order Bao Fang
Formula, the process to slave computer carries out the startup of band parameter, start by set date, the manipulation such as timing stops, monitoring;Or, methods described is also
Other slave computers can be carried out to start online, start by set date is online, and timing stopping is online etc. by website control command packet mode
Manipulation;Also or, methods described can also realize communication between points, including one-to-one or one-to-many point-to- point communication,
The communication between points includes TCP transmission mode and disconnected UDP transmission means.TCP modes are used for long data block
Duplication and synchronization, UDP be used for low volume data transmission.For example, periodic data UDP transmission means, the data of event
Use TCP transmission mode.
Or, when it is described send the packet within queue and be issued to slave computer when, the host computer can not be directly issued to down
During the machine of position, then slave computer is forwarded to by remote controllers, wherein, the host computer is sent to remote controllers, then by remote
Corresponding data transmit queue is issued to correspondence slave computer by range controller.
Meanwhile, it is used in the present embodiment under different operating system platform (Windows or acceptance of the bid kylin), host computer is with
Network service when each application program is with transmission data between position machine or host computer and host computer or slave computer and slave computer connects
Mouthful, including:Process between notification interface, different computers is sent on same computer between process and notifies transmission interface, file
Transmission interface, internal memory synchronized transmission interface, transmission peration data interface;For example, being sent when to the specified process in specified machine
Notify, send and notify that pack arrangement is as shown in Figure 3.
The interface of other applications is supplied in the present embodiment methods described to be included:Message, internal memory and dynamic base, due to
The present embodiment methods described is operated under different operating system (Windows or acceptance of the bid kylin), but two kinds of different operation systems
Unite different to the definition of message, so the present embodiment uses QT local Socket technologies encapsulation messages mechanism, realize between process
Message communicating, its external interface form use class Windows message mode.
